Comparison between IEC 60880 and IEC 61508 for certification purposes in the nuclear domain

  • Authors:
  • Jussi Lahtinen;Mika Johansson;Jukka Ranta;Hannu Harju;Risto Nevalainen

  • Affiliations:
  • VTT Technical Research Centre of Finland, Finland;Tampereen Teknillinen Yliopisto, Pori, Finland;VTT Technical Research Centre of Finland, Finland;VTT Technical Research Centre of Finland, Finland;Tampereen Teknillinen Yliopisto, Pori, Finland

  • Venue:
  • SAFECOMP'10 Proceedings of the 29th international conference on Computer safety, reliability, and security
  • Year:
  • 2010

Quantified Score

Hi-index 0.00

Visualization

Abstract

In the nuclear domain, regulators have strict requirements for safetycritical software. In this paper requirements in three documents (two software standards and the Common Position of nuclear domain regulators) were compared. The aim of the work was to find out how these requirements compare to each other in terms of strictness and scope, and to evaluate the usefulness of the documents for certification purposes. Another goal was to determine whether it is possible to choose only one of the standards as the basis of software certification. The nuclear domain software standard IEC 60880 provides requirements for the purpose of achieving highly reliable software. The standard is similar to the part 3 of IEC 61508 standard in the sense that it covers requirements for all software lifecycle activities. The Common Position document "Licensing of safety critical software for nuclear reactors" states the requirements from the perspective of European nuclear regulators. The comparison was twofold. First, the absolute 'shall' requirements of a few key themes were extracted from all three documents. The strictness of these requirements was analyzed against each other. Second, to evaluate the documents' usefulness for certification, the extent in which these themes were covered by each document was analyzed by expert judgment. The main result was that the use of IEC 60880 alone is not sufficient for software certification.